Jonathan founded HomeMatchup on a single unfashionable idea: that a homeowner should be able to check the claim rather than believe it. Fifteen years in home services and lead generation taught him that the industry's core problem is not a shortage of contractors - there are thousands - but that every one of them sounds equally certain, and the work gets covered up the day after it is finished.

He is responsible for the two rules the business runs on and loses money to. A contractor cannot buy their way into a match, and a homeowner's details go to their matched pros and never onto a list. He is also the reason this site says plainly that HomeMatchup does not yet verify licences or insurance, rather than implying a check the company has not built.

He sets editorial independence policy, which in practice means the commercial side of the business has no say over what a cost page says a job should cost.

What this profile does not claim

Jonathan is a real member of the HomeMatchup team and the role and experience above are accurate. You will notice what is missing: no licence numbers, no certifications, no former employers, no awards.

That is deliberate. We ask every contractor in our network to prove their credentials at the source before we will introduce them to you, and it would be indefensible to decorate our own profiles with claims you have no way to check. Where a team member holds a verifiable public credential, it will appear here with a way to look it up - and not before.
